.loginTxt{text-align:center;width:100px;margin-right:auto;margin:20px auto 15px auto;font-size:26px;color:#404040;border-bottom:1px solid #8b8a88;padding-bottom:15px}.loginContent{background:#fff;width:100%;max-width:400px;min-height:355px;margin-left:auto;border-radius:4px;padding:15px;border-top:2px solid #593e8a;border-left:0;border-right:0;border-bottom:0;margin-right:auto}.Chng_Passwrd{width:100%;max-width:400px;margin:10px auto;position:absolute;left:50%;transform:translate(-50%);top:-70px}.outer_loginSection{margin-top:13%;position:relative}.googleCapture{float:left;margin:10px 0;min-height:70px;width:100%;text-align:center}.chkBox{float:left;width:100%;margin:10px 0}.chkBox span{font-size:15px;position:absolute;margin:0 0 0 7px}.loginButton{background-color:#593e8a;color:#fff;border-radius:0;margin-right:15px;margin-top:15px;padding:13px 0;width:100%;border:0;font-size:16px}.loginButton:hover{background-color:#20004f}.g-recaptcha>div{text-align:center;float:none;margin-left:auto;margin-right:auto}p.forgetPassword{margin-top:15px}.input-group{margin-top:15px;width:100%}.input-group .form-control{position:relative;z-index:2;float:left;width:100%;margin-bottom:0}.BorderBottom{border-bottom:1px solid #8b8a88;border-top:0;border-left:0;background:#fff;border-right:0;font-size:16px;height:55px;padding:5px 5px 5px 30px}.textIcons{position:absolute;left:10px;top:20px;font-size:16px;z-index:99;color:#8b8a88}#Forgotton_password{z-index:9999;margin-top:50px}#Forgotton_password .modal-header{background:#593e8a}#Forgotton_password .modal-header .close{color:#fff;opacity:1}#Forgotton_password .custm_input_forget{width:100%;max-width:330px;margin:10px 0 0 0;height:33px}#Forgotton_password .custm_btn_{background:#593e8a;color:#fff}#Forgotton_password .custm_btn_:hover{background:#fff;color:#593e8a;border-color:#593e8a}@media(max-width:767px){.Chng_Passwrd{top:-85px}.outer_loginSection{margin-top:30%}.custm_checkbox_password .checkbox.text-right{text-align:left}}@media(min-width:768px){.modal-dialog{width:363px;margin:30px auto}}@media all and (-ms-high-contrast:none),(-ms-high-contrast:active){.outer_loginSection{margin-top:0 !important;position:relative}section.loginSection{padding-top:13%}}